The present invention relates to wall mounting devices. More particularly, the present invention provides a wall mounting bracket that allows items to be displayed from a wall surface. The wall mounting bracket includes a base portion removably securable to the wall surface and an adjustable shaft having a fastener configured to removably fasten to the desired display item.
Many people collect many different types of toys. Some people collect action figures, and others collect figurines. Generally, figurines are figures that have been created to represent a certain character. They typically are molded and have no movable body parts. Furthermore, these figurines are molded with a base to make it easier to stand them up for display. On the other hand, action figures are also toys that are created to represent particular characters, however, they are designed to have at least one movable body part. Action figures can be moved and posed in a variety of positions, but they are harder to display because they lack a base portion.
Generally, collectors can either keep their action figures or figurines within their original packaging. Either way, many collectors have a desire to display these action figures or figurines instead of storing them in a closet. One typical method of hanging these action figures or figurines is to hang them from a wall. Collectors push thumbtacks into the wall and use string to hang the action figures or figures from each thumbtack. Needless to say, sometimes these thumbtacks are not configured to support the weight of heavier items. Therefore, there exists a need for a new and improved wall mounting bracket that allows a user to suspend heavier items thereon.

The present invention provides a wall mounting bracket configured to allow a user to removably fasten heavier items thereto to be displayed on a wall surface. The wall mounting bracket includes a base portion having an interior face and an exterior face, wherein the interior face is removably adhered to a wall surface via an adhesive. The exterior face includes an adjustable shaft that is centrally disposed thereon. The adjustable shaft is configured to be bent and manipulated to a user's desire, and configured to maintain the bent shape. The adjustable shaft includes a fastener thereon configured to removably fasten an item thereto. Preferably, the fastener is a C-shape clamp configured to removably clamp to the desired item to be displayed.

The mounting bracket 20 includes a base portion 21 having an interior face 22 and an exterior face 23. Preferably, the base portion 21 is rectangular in shape, however, other shapes and sizes of the base portion 21 are alternatively used in other embodiments. These variations and sizes are deemed within the spirit and scope of the inventive embodiments described herein. The interior face 22 is configured to be placed flush against a wall surface via an adhesive 24. Preferably, the adhesive 24 is a strong epoxy glue, however, other suitable means of adhesive are also likewise contemplated. In some embodiments, the interior face 22 is removably secured to a wall surface via a fastener, such as a bolt, screw, or nail, among others.
The exterior face 23 of the base portion 21 includes an adjustable shaft 25 extending outwardly therefrom. Preferably, the adjustable shaft 25 is centrally located, however, it is readily envisioned that those of ordinary skill in the art will anticipate a variety of other preferable locations for the shaft to be disposed on the exterior face 23 that achieve the function, purpose and advantages described herein. These alterations, variations, and modifications are likewise contemplated. The adjustable shaft 25 includes a first end 26 and a second end 27, wherein the first end 26 is permanently affixed to the base portion 21. The second end 27 includes a fastener 28 configured to removably fasten an item thereon.
The adjustable shaft 25 is preferably composed of a flexible or bendable material, such as a metal wire, which is still rigid enough to maintain a bent configuration while supporting items thereon. In some embodiments, the adjustable shaft 25 is composed from a gooseneck that allows for adjustment. In this way, the user can manipulate and bend the adjustable shaft 25 in order to reposition an item supported thereon without having to detach the base portion 21 from the wall surface.
Referring now to
In operation, a user can position a portion of the body of an action figure or figurine within the C-shaped clamp. The action figure fits frictionally within the clamp so that the action figure is partially encircled by the clamp. In some embodiments, the clamp is adjustable so that the tightness of the clamp on the action figure can be readily adjusted by the user.
